Kroger and Uber Eats expand partnership for grocery delivery nationwide

Kroger Co. (NYSE: KR) and Uber Technologies Inc. (NYSE: UBER) announced an expanded partnership that will integrate grocery delivery and restaurant services across digital platforms.
Beginning early 2026, customers will be able to order from more than 2,600 Kroger stores through the Uber Eats app, including banners such as Ralphs, Fred Meyer, King Soopers, Smith's, Fry's, Harris Teeter, and Mariano's. The service will offer the full store assortment including fresh groceries, household items, and Kroger's private-label products.
The partnership introduces cross-loyalty benefits between the companies' membership programs. Kroger Boost members will receive an extended free trial of Uber One, which provides 6% cash back and automatic surge savings on rides, $0 delivery fees, and up to 10% off Uber Eats orders. Uber One members will have access to an extended free trial of Kroger's Boost membership, including 2X fuel points and $0 delivery fees for orders on Kroger.com or the Kroger app.
Uber Eats restaurant selection will be integrated directly into the Kroger app, allowing customers to order groceries and restaurant meals within the same platform. Kroger stated it will be the first retailer to offer this combined service with $0 delivery fees and reduced service fees for Boost members.
The companies will also collaborate on retail media experiences for brands to engage customers with relevant products and promotions.
"Our customers want to choose how they shop, when they shop and how they access their groceries," said Yael Cosset, executive vice president and chief digital officer at Kroger.
Susan Anderson, Global Head of Delivery at Uber, said Kroger is the first retailer to bring Uber Eats directly into its digital shopping experience and connect the two membership ecosystems.
The announcement builds on an existing relationship between the companies, according to the press release.
